Summary
Following the confirmation of one nominee, the council voted to continue several other commission appointments for one week so members can interview nominees and review qualifications under the revised charter.
After confirming Michael Kesten, the Los Angeles City Council voted on July 26, 2000, to continue consideration of several other mayoral commission appointments for one week. Councilmember Ridley-Thomas moved the continuance to give members additional time for review; the motion…
